Molly's Gift Small Grants Fund
Molly’s Gift is a charity set up in honour of Loughborough Foxes Vixens captain, Molly Webb. Molly sadly passed away from sepsis on 6th January 2019, at just 25 years old. The charity aims to support local children and young people in a variety of ways. The small grants are one way they aim to do this, with their work particularly focussed on disadvantaged children; something that was incredibly close to Molly’s heart.

About Molly's Gift Small Grants Fund
We hope that each approved grant enables children and young people from all walks of life to further pursue their sporting talent and participation. Whether this be through one off activities, to purchase equipment or pay for facilities. Ultimately, funds can support local sports / physical activity clubs, primary schools, community projects. We also fund individuals through applications to simply support them to smile through being active.
